Comprehending Crypto Casinos
A crypto casino is an online gambling platform that accepts cryptocurrencies-- such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T)-- as a medium of exchange. Unlike traditional casinos that depend on banking intermediaries and internal processing times, crypto casinos use blockchain innovation to facilitate near-instantaneous deposits and withdrawals.
The main appeal for users depends on the sovereignty over their funds and the openness offered by the blockchain. By getting rid of the need for a bank to veterinarian or authorize transactions, these platforms produce a smooth environment for international gamers to engage with their preferred video games.

1. Provably Fair Games
Among the most considerable developments in the crypto space is the "Provably Fair" algorithm. This permits gamers to verify the randomness and fairness of each game outcome using cryptographic hashes. It removes the "black box" nature of traditional Random Number Generators (RNGs).

4. Crash Games
Crash games are a distinct item of the crypto era. In these video games, a multiplier begins at 1.00 x and climbs up gradually. The goal is to squander before the curve "crashes." It is a fast-paced, high-adrenaline video game that completely matches the volatility of the crypto market.

Essential Security Measures for Players
While the innovation behind crypto is secure, the user is ultimately responsible for their own safety. Engaging with crypto gambling establishments requires a proactive approach to cybersecurity:
- Use Hardware Wallets: Never keep large amounts of cryptocurrency on the casino platform. Transfer funds to a private, hardware-based wallet (freezer) after a winning session.
- Enable 2FA: Always activate Two-Factor Authentication utilizing an authenticator app (like Google Authenticator or Authy) rather than SMS-based 2FA, which is susceptible to SIM-swapping.
- Verify Licensing: Only play at gambling establishments that hold valid licenses from respectable jurisdictions, such as Curacao or the Malta Gaming Authority.
- Practice Responsible Gambling: Set strict deposit limitations and adhere to an established budget. The speed of crypto transactions can make it simple to overspend if one is not disciplined.
The Future of Crypto Wagering
The combination of blockchain technology is set to deepen. We are currently seeing the increase of decentralized casinos (DApps) that operate totally by means of wise contracts. In these environments, the code is the casino, and payments are distributed immediately by the contract rather than by a main entity. As DeFi (Decentralized Finance) matures, it is likely that Crypto Casino USA casinos will provide even more intricate monetary products, such as staking benefits for platform liquidity companies.

Q: What is a "Provably Fair" game?A: It is a system that permits gamers to verify that the result of a video game was figured out by a random seed and not controlled by the casino. It utilizes cryptographic hashing to prove the integrity of every spin or deal.
Q: Can I lose cash if the crypto market crashes?A: Yes. Due to the fact that you are holding and wagering digital properties, the market value of your balance and your jackpots will fluctuate according to the cost of the cryptocurrency you are using. If the coin cost drops, the fiat equivalent of your payouts drops also.
Q: How long do withdrawals take?A: Withdrawal speed depends upon the network blockage of the blockchain being utilized (e.g., Bitcoin vs. Solana). Typically, crypto withdrawals are processed within minutes or hours, compared to the days needed for standard bank withdrawals.
